Shubman Gill was expected to get picked in India’s limited-overs squad for the tour of West Indies. But, he wasn’t named in India’s squad that was announced on Sunday, which was highly surprising especially after his golden run for India A in Windies. Chief selector, MSK Prasad said that the youngster will have to wait for his chances. 

“He was given an opportunity when KL Rahul was out against New Zealand, he will have to wait for his turn,” MSK Prasad was quoted as saying by India today. Gill racked up three fifties in four games against Windies A and was even adjudged Player-of-the-tournament. 

The teen sensation averages 104.46 in Youth ODIs. He rose to prominence when he was named the Player-of-the-Tournament in the 2018 U19 World Cup, which India won. The right-hander has made 1,942 runs in List-A cricket at an average of 47.36. He averages 77.78 after playing nine First-Class games. So, far he has played two ODIs for India as well.
